Theoretical underpinning: Bitcoin mining rigs convert electricity into hashes, seeking to solve cryptographic puzzles that validate transactions on the blockchain. The more hashes per joule of energy, the more bang you get for your buck—or rather, your kilowatt-hour. According to the 2025 Crypto Energy Efficiency Report by the Blockchain Strategic Institute, **the average power consumption of top-tier rigs has dropped by 18% compared to just two years ago**, reflecting rapid innovation in ASIC (Application Specific Integrated Circuit) design. Efficiency is king—not just in theory, but in the balance sheet.

Case in point: The Antminer S19 XP, boasting an impressive 140 TH/s at around 21.5 J/TH, is the industry’s poster child for efficient mining. Compared to its predecessor, the S19 Pro, it consumes roughly 18% less power per terahash without sacrificing hashrate. Miners operating this rig in regions with moderate electricity costs saw profitability spikes upwards of 25% during Q1 2025, per data from MiningRig Insights.

Now, let’s switch gears to a rudimentary truth: **not all rigs are cut from the same cloth**. While SHA-256-focused Bitcoin miners dominate the market, you have Ethereum miners mining Ethash and even the Dogecoin faithful dabbling in merged mining setups. These distinctions impact efficiency, energy costs, and ultimately, ROI.

Here’s where jargon like ‘Joules per Terahash’ (J/TH) and ‘Power Usage Effectiveness’ (PUE) become your daily bread. **PUE measures how much extra energy is consumed beyond the mining rig itself, often due to cooling and auxiliary systems**, a critical cost center in large-scale mining farms. If you’re eyeing a hosting solution or your own farm, digging into these specs isn’t optional—it’s survival.

2025 statistics from the Global Crypto Mining Council illustrate that hosting mining rigs at specialized facilities with PUE below 1.1 can slash operational energy costs by 15-20% compared to home setups averaging a PUE of 1.5 or more. Case in the spotlight: Genesis Digital Assets, a mining farm operator, reported a 12% jump in net margins after migrating several hundred S19 XP units to ultra-efficient colocation centers with renewable energy sourcing.
